About Us

Wesley Church Community Garden was established in 2011 through a generous grant, with the mission of growing fresh produce to help meet the increasing food needs in our community. Since then, we have been continuously growing and expanding, striving to feed more people as food insecurity continues to rise in our area.

At Wesley Church Community Garden, we believe in the power of community and the importance of fresh, nutritious food. Our mission is simple yet impactful: to feed our community by growing fresh produce and donating at least 50% of our harvest to local food banks.

Our Mission

We are dedicated to:

  • Growing Fresh Produce: We cultivate a variety of fruits, vegetables, and herbs, ensuring a diverse and healthy harvest.
  • Supporting Local Food Banks: At least half of our produce is donated to local food banks, helping to nourish those in need.
  • Empowering Volunteers: Those who work in our garden can take home a portion of the harvest, providing fresh food for their own families.
